The short version
Average GCSE results. 79% capacity. Rated Good by Ofsted (2018).
- GCSE results are broadly in line with the national average (Attainment 8: 44.8 vs national 43.8)
- Rated Good by Ofsted in 2018
- This school does not have a sixth form

Attendance
In practice: Pupils miss about 17 days per year on average — nearly a month of school.
26% of pupils miss 10% or more of school
4% of pupils miss half or more of school sessions
Source: DfE School Census

Questions parents ask
Is Friern Barnet School a selective school?
No. Friern Barnet School is non-selective, so admission does not depend on an entrance exam.
What is Friern Barnet School's Ofsted rating?
Friern Barnet School was rated Good at its most recent inspection in February 2024. Full reports are linked on this page.
How many pupils attend Friern Barnet School?
Friern Barnet School currently has 641 pupils on roll, according to the latest Department for Education data.
What ages does Friern Barnet School take?
Friern Barnet School caters for pupils aged 11 to 16. It is classified as a secondary school.
Where is Friern Barnet School?
Friern Barnet School is in London, N11 3LS, in the Barnet local authority area. The map on this page shows the exact location and nearby schools.
Does Friern Barnet School have a sixth form?
No, Friern Barnet School does not have a sixth form. Pupils move to a different school or college for post-16 study.
